Home Federal Bancorp, Inc. of Louisiana (NASDAQ:HFBL) and Kentucky First Federal Bancorp (NASDAQ:KFFB) are both small-cap finance companies, but which is the superior investment? We will compare the two businesses based on the strength of their risk, earnings, profitability, dividends, community ranking, analyst recommendations, valuation, media sentiment and institutional ownership.
Home Federal Bancorp, Inc. of Louisiana received 19 more outperform votes than Kentucky First Federal Bancorp when rated by MarketBeat users. Likewise, 61.31% of users gave Home Federal Bancorp, Inc. of Louisiana an outperform vote while only 60.00% of users gave Kentucky First Federal Bancorp an outperform vote.
Home Federal Bancorp, Inc. of Louisiana has a net margin of 12.62% compared to Kentucky First Federal Bancorp's net margin of -3.85%. Home Federal Bancorp, Inc. of Louisiana's return on equity of 8.17% beat Kentucky First Federal Bancorp's return on equity.
21.1% of Home Federal Bancorp, Inc. of Louisiana shares are owned by institutional investors. Comparatively, 3.2% of Kentucky First Federal Bancorp shares are owned by institutional investors. 24.8% of Home Federal Bancorp, Inc. of Louisiana shares are owned by insiders. Comparatively, 5.3% of Kentucky First Federal Bancorp shares are owned by insiders. Strong institutional ownership is an indication that hedge funds, large money managers and endowments believe a stock will outperform the market over the long term.
In the previous week, Home Federal Bancorp, Inc. of Louisiana had 1 more articles in the media than Kentucky First Federal Bancorp. MarketBeat recorded 6 mentions for Home Federal Bancorp, Inc. of Louisiana and 5 mentions for Kentucky First Federal Bancorp. Kentucky First Federal Bancorp's average media sentiment score of 1.04 beat Home Federal Bancorp, Inc. of Louisiana's score of 0.67 indicating that Kentucky First Federal Bancorp is being referred to more favorably in the news media.
Home Federal Bancorp, Inc. of Louisiana has a beta of 0.5, suggesting that its stock price is 50% less volatile than the S&P 500. Comparatively, Kentucky First Federal Bancorp has a beta of 0.26, suggesting that its stock price is 74% less volatile than the S&P 500.
Home Federal Bancorp, Inc. of Louisiana has higher revenue and earnings than Kentucky First Federal Bancorp. Kentucky First Federal Bancorp is trading at a lower price-to-earnings ratio than Home Federal Bancorp, Inc. of Louisiana, indicating that it is currently the more affordable of the two stocks.
Summary
Home Federal Bancorp, Inc. of Louisiana beats Kentucky First Federal Bancorp on 13 of the 15 factors compared between the two stocks.
